With five documents in the SMPTE ST 2110 standards suites published, now more than ever you need a working knowledge of the essential principles of IP video and audio transport for production and broadcasting facilities. These new standards are fundamental to the industry’s migration to all-IP operations, and many media organizations and technology suppliers have already embraced SMPTE ST 2110.

Intended for engineers who need to understand in detail the SMPTE ST 2110 suite of standards.

 What you will learn:

  • Explain the evolution to IP at the core of managed professional media facilities and its impact on the broadcast industry beyond just replacing SDI with IP
  • Apply the new standards to work with media over IP networks in real-time
  • Leverage IT protocols and infrastructure to develop and implement a whole new set of applications
